Top Missouri Schools for a Doctorate in Civil Engineering

Our 2023 rankings named University of Missouri - Columbia the best school in Missouri for civil engineering students working on their doctor’s degree. Mizzou is a fairly large public school located in the city of Columbia.

A rank of #2 on this year’s list means Missouri University of Science and Technology is a great place for civil engineering students working on their doctor’s degree. Missouri University of Science and Technology is a moderately-sized public school located in the remote town of Rolla.
